Too bad memory doesn't want to go any higher even with this mod. It stops at 1150MHz (2300MHz DDR).
Anyway, GPU is 20°C cooler on full load, and in idle it's 40°C cooler than with stock cooling
I knew that my trusty Zalman VF-900 (i call it VF-950 now because of the fan upgrade) is not retired yet. Ppl even said to me it won't be able to keep up with the HD4850 temperatures. I call all that BS. It's more than capable of cooling the RV770! And at very high clocks not some stock crap...
